Abstract

The invention provides a pesticide compound containing cyhalodiamide and hexaflumuron and used for agricultural pests. The weight ratio of the cyhalodiamide to the hexaflumuron is 50:1-1:50. The pesticide compound provided by the invention is effective, low in toxicity, long in lasting period and capable of effectively preventing and killing crop lepidoptera pests.

Background technology
The resistance problem of agricultural pests is a global problem.With the continuity of Chemical Control of Harmful Insects, Pesticide use amount Increase and not scientifical use pesticide, pest resistance is increasingly serious, and the pest species for producing resistance are on the increase.Particularly to agriculture The Lepidoptera class pest that industry production is caused harm serious, resistance level is higher, and resistance development speed is relatively fast.Meanwhile, high intensity Using pesticide, cause exceeded Practice for Pesticide Residue in Agricultural Products, environmental pollution and peasant's drug cost to increase etc., it is unfavorable for that agricultural is sustainable Development.Therefore, efficient, low toxicity, the pesticide of environmental protection are researched and developed there is positive effect to agricultural sustainable development.
HEXAFLUMURON (Hexaflumuron) is benzoyl area kind insect growth regulator, IGR, is killed by suppressing insect chitin synthesis Dead insect.With insecticidal activity is high, insecticidal spectrum compared with it is wide, knock down power it is strong the features such as.
Chlorine fluorine cyanogen insect amide is the novel pesticide that Zhejiang Provincial Chemical Engineering Research Inst is voluntarily developed, code name ZJ4042, and chemical name is: The chloro- N of 3-1- (2- methyl -4- sevoflurane isopropyl bases)-N2- (1- methyl isophthalic acids-cyano ethyl) phthalyl Amine, shown in structural formula following (I):
The insecticide belongs to new phthalic amide insecticides, by calcium release channel in the blue Buddhist nun's alkali recipient cell of activation, causes storage The runaway release of calcium ion, is the compounds for acting on insect cell orchid Buddhist nun's alkali (Ryanodine) receptor few in number at present. There is wide spectrum preventive effect to lepidoptera pest.
Drug cost is higher when chlorine fluorine cyanogen insect amide is used alone, and its popularization and application is limited to a certain extent.HEXAFLUMURON consumption Larger, long-term exclusive use easily causes pest resistance degree and is continuously increased.Therefore, chlorine fluorine cyanogen insect amide and HEXAFLUMURON are carried out Mixture, is a kind of effective ways of the agriculture resistant insect of preventing and treating.

First, biological activity determination
Test is with reference to pesticide indoor bioassay test rule (agricultural industry criteria NY/T1154.7-2006) and initiative Pesticide bioactivity evaluates SOP (insecticide volume), using infusion process.
Synergy is calculated using following methods:
Contents (%) of the toxicity index × A of mixed toxicity index (the TTI)=A of theory in mixed
Contents (%) of the toxicity index × B of+B in mixed
If co-toxicity coefficient is more than 120, show there is potentiation;If being less than 80, antagonism is shown to be;If being less than more than 80 120, it is shown to be summation action.
Embodiment 1:The compositionss of chlorine fluorine cyanogen insect amide and HEXAFLUMURON
The compositionss of the chlorine fluorine cyanogen insect amide of table 1 and HEXAFLUMURON are acted on the synergy of beet armyworm (Spodoptera exigua)
Process Proportioning LC50(mg/L) Actual measurement toxicity index Theoretical toxicity index Co-toxicity coefficient
ZJ4042 - 0.378 100.00 - -
HEXAFLUMURON - 3.782 9.41 - -
ZJ4042:HEXAFLUMURON 1:50 2.485 14.37 11.22 128.10
ZJ4042:HEXAFLUMURON 1:20 2.014 17.73 13.75 128.90
ZJ4042:HEXAFLUMURON 1:9 1.352 26.41 18.50 142.77
ZJ4042:HEXAFLUMURON 1:7 1.094 32.63 20.76 157.19
ZJ4042:HEXAFLUMURON 1:3 0.684 52.19 32.08 162.70
ZJ4042:HEXAFLUMURON 1:2 0.538 66.36 39.63 167.46
ZJ4042:HEXAFLUMURON 1:1 0.374 95.45 54.72 174.44
ZJ4042:HEXAFLUMURON 3:1 0.338 105.62 77.36 136.53
ZJ4042:HEXAFLUMURON 5:1 0.309 115.53 84.91 136.07
ZJ4042:HEXAFLUMURON 20:1 0.303 117.82 95.69 123.13
ZJ4042:HEXAFLUMURON 50:1 0.301 118.60 98.22 120.75
From table 1 it follows that the compositionss of chlorine fluorine cyanogen insect amide and HEXAFLUMURON for examination target beet armyworm to having very high killing Worm activity, after chlorine fluorine cyanogen insect amide and HEXAFLUMURON mixture significant potentiation is shown, and the activity of mixture is significantly higher than control Single dose.Wherein chlorine fluorine cyanogen insect amide and HEXAFLUMURON proportioning are 1:9~5:1 potentiation is more than other proportionings.
